Malcolm Purvis <malcolmp(a)xemacs.org> wrote:
What would need to be done to turn function pointers into their own
datatype?
No, that's nonsense. It seemed to make sense when I wrote it just
before going to bed last night ...
What we really need to do is to find all the places where function
pointers are being dumped and make them be XD_OPAQUE_PTR_CONVERTIBLE
instead of whatever they are now. We would also have to write the
encoding and decoding functions, but from what I've read so far, that
would not be exceptionally difficult.
I'm willing to help with this, but I have no access to an IA64 box.
I'll commit OG's stuff later today so everybody can see it.
--
Jerry James
http://www.ittc.ku.edu/~james/